I’ve come to Borgo C a number of times for lunch. The food here is quite simple but is tasty. The menu is Chinese with a bit of western influence. I wouldn’t call it fusion but it’s not a typical tea restaurant or fast casual Hong along restaurant.
Food: 3.5 stars Value: 4 stars Service: 4 stars Overall: 3.5 stars
The lunch sets are pretty good deal and they come with a dessert. If you have a big appetite you may not get full but for an average person the portion size is adequate.
